The adventure film They Reach, starring Mary Madaline Roe, Morgan Chandler, Eden Campbell, etc., directed by Sylas Dall, was released on November 3, 2020 in États-Unis. It tells the story of En 1979, une jeune fille trouve un lecteur de cassettes qui a été possédé. Sans le savoir, elle libère une entité démoniaque qui hante sa famille et entraîne lentement la petite ville de Clarkston dans l'enfer. This is an Adventure, Comédie, Horreur film with a runtime of 87 minutes and its worldwide box office is not listed in the available detail data. It has received a rating of 4.5/10 from 1,341 viewers.

In reviewing a bad film, I try to look for something positive to say. The highlight of They Reach is the delightful Eden Campbell as Cheddar, best friend of lead girl Jessica. Campbell easily steals the film. Her funny performance makes me want to see her star in a teen comedy as that type of character - a bold, boisterous, fast-talking, quick-witted, rambunctious girl eagerly embracing mischief and shenanigans. She reminds me a bit of Eden Sher, in being someone who isn't just giving a good comic performance, but who comes across as a funny person. Give her a film with a better script and more focus on her as a comedic lead, I think she'd be fantastic.
They Reach is a..sort of bad movie overall. In all honestly very little does happen, and if they went for the Let's show less on screen in order to provoke the viewer's imagination.. well first of all, give me something, the bare minimum, let me have a starting point no? I wish I'd like it, it has a cool vintage vibe, good characters, good development until one point, and once the third act begins, it feels like we're still trapped in the second one. Almost anything interesting happens off screen, and I get it, perhaps to make it more friendly, maybe because of the budget, but shadow actions will get you only so far, and I think this was the movie's biggest problem. It had so little to show for, and no clear, obvious danger on screen...just some..well, you'll see. I don't want to ruin it for anyone, just lower you expectations as much as you can and just maybe, perhaps you might enjoy it. I simply felt that it dragged itself for too long without ever making that one step, that would get you there, in the middle of the action. I do not recommend it but I will do so with Summer of 84. It has a similar feel but manages to give the viewer some closure, it's not perfect in any way but manages to bring up some nostalgia. It's just much better done than They Reach. Cheers!
They Reach starts off badly and gets worse from there. The movie begins when a Dr. Quinnley and his son Alex are visiting a woman whose son is possessed by an entity. The movie skips 10 years and continues with a girl called Jessica getting a tape player from an antique store in 1979 after the death of her brother. The same tape player used to record an attempted exorcism ten years earlier. Jessica cuts herself while trying to fix it and bleeds all over it. Soon weird stuff happens, there are apparitions and people start seeing things which are not there. The movie is badly written and the family reaction to the death of their son is not very well portrayed in the film. They seem to come back from the funeral and within minutes the mother is asking the girl about a science project. The characters are mostly one dimensional and wooden and most of of the acting is bad although the kid actors are ok more or less and seem to have the most fleshed out characters and show the most promise out of the whole cast. The dialogue gets worse and worse and the dialogue between the two main cops in the movie is cringeworthy. Not really worth watching as there are many other horrors out there that do the material better. A 3/10.
A lot of reviewers, some of whom, I supect have not seen this film, have, in my opinion, been very unfair to it. "They Reach" is by no means a bad little horror film. There's a real "Stranger Things" meets "The Goonies" vibe on offer here, rounded out with a 70's nostalgia trip, that's done extremely well. This is balanced by surprisingly excellent acting from younger cast members in particular, who really steal the show. The horror effects are nothing special but they don't really need to be. In spite of the blood and minor gore, this is on a certain level a dark horror comedy. Its not supposed to be taken too seriously. In short this ones a winner. Its inherently likable, watchable and entertainingly silly in a scary demonic kind of way. 7/10 from me.
